LMI is a forward-thinking company that focuses on reimagining the path from insight to outcome through innovative solutions in various sectors, including applied AI and digital health. They provide advanced analytics, engineering support, and performance optimization across defense, health, and civilian markets, with a strong commitment to enhancing mission effectiveness for government clients. With a focus on collaboration and research, LMI aims to drive positive change through its diverse capabilities and partnerships.

đź“‹ Description

• Support the Defense Health Agency Revenue Cycle Operating System initiative • Design and develop advanced analytics within Databricks using Python, SQL, Spark/PySpark, statistical methods, and machine-learning techniques • Develop Databricks visualizations, Databricks SQL dashboards, AI/BI dashboards, and native visualization capabilities • Create interactive dashboards for DHA J-8, DHN, MTF, revenue-cycle, coding, financial, and executive users • Translate analytical models into visualizations showing financial exposure, recovery opportunity, trends, root causes, outliers, and recommended operational priorities • Develop command-level RevOS SITREP dashboards using Healthy/At Risk/Critical indicators across Front, Middle, and Back Office revenue-cycle processes • Develop drill-down analytics from enterprise and DHN levels through MTF, department, provider, encounter, claim, and claim-line levels • Design analytical models identifying and quantifying revenue leakage and recovery opportunities • Analyze encounter, documentation, coding, charge, claim, denial, adjudication, payment, and accounts-receivable data • Develop detection logic for missing or incomplete charges, uncoded or delayed encounters, coding errors, claims-readiness defects, denied or rejected claims, underpayments, unmatched remittances, aged claims and receivables, and eligibility or authorization failures • Develop recoverability and priority-scoring models • Develop payer-performance and denial analytics • Build predictive models identifying revenue-cycle failures before lost revenue or excessive Days-to-Bill • Establish baselines and anomaly-detection methodologies • Design financial-impact methodologies estimating potentially recoverable revenue • Develop and validate standardized RevOS KPIs and analytical measures • Support the RevOS Revenue Opportunity Ledger • Create dashboard views connecting aggregate metrics to the Revenue Opportunity Ledger and actionable work queues • Partner with Data Engineers to ensure Silver and Gold structures support analytics and dashboard performance • Optimize analytical queries and calculations for responsive enterprise-scale visualization • Validate models, KPIs, and dashboard calculations against authoritative source records • Develop analytical data products for coding audit, payer scoring, denial management, revenue recovery, financial reconciliation, and audit remediation • Document model purpose, features, methodology, validation, performance, refresh cadence, limitations, and version history • Support model monitoring, validation, retraining, and ModelOps practices

🎯 Requirements

• 8+ years of professional experience in data science, advanced analytics, quantitative analysis, machine learning, or related disciplines • Strong hands-on experience with Databricks • Demonstrated ability to use Databricks native visualization and dashboard capabilities, including Databricks SQL and/or AI/BI dashboards • Experience designing operational, analytical, and executive dashboards based on large enterprise datasets • Advanced proficiency with Python and SQL • Experience with Spark/PySpark or comparable distributed-computing technologies • Experience developing predictive models, anomaly detection, classification, prioritization/scoring models, or similar analytical capabilities • Strong understanding of feature engineering, model validation, statistical testing, and analytical quality assurance • Experience working with complex financial, operational, healthcare, claims, payment, or transactional data • Ability to translate business and operational problems into measurable analytical hypotheses and production-ready analytical products • Strong ability to communicate complex analytical findings through visualizations and dashboards to both technical and non-technical users • Experience developing KPIs that reconcile to authoritative data sources • Understanding of modern lakehouse and Bronze/Silver/Gold architectures • Ability to work with Data Engineers and Architects to define data structures required for analytics and visualization • Experience developing auditable and explainable analytical methodologies appropriate for financial or regulated environments • Ability to operate within Agile product-development and iterative delivery environments • Ability to meet applicable DHA/DoD security, privacy, access, and data-handling requirements • Applicants must meet eligibility requirements for a U.S. Government security clearance • Only US Citizens are eligible for a security clearance • LMI will only consider applicants with security clearances or applicants who are eligible for security clearances • Preferred: Prior experience with Advana and/or the current War Data Platform (WDP) • Preferred: Experience developing dashboards and analytical products within a DoD Databricks environment • Preferred: Experience with Databricks Unity Catalog, Delta Lake, Databricks SQL, AI/BI Dashboards, MLflow, Workflows, or related capabilities • Preferred: Healthcare revenue-cycle experience, including coding, claims, charge capture, denials, AR, remittance, payer reimbursement, and underpayment analysis • Preferred: Familiarity with healthcare payer transaction data such as 835, 837, 270/271, 276/277, and 278 transactions • Preferred: Experience with MHS GENESIS, Oracle Health/Cerner Millennium, Abacus, or similar healthcare systems • Preferred: Experience supporting federal financial management, audit remediation, or revenue-recognition initiatives • Preferred: Familiarity with certified data products, lineage, data governance, and data-quality controls • Preferred: Experience developing explainable AI/ML capabilities in regulated or Government environments
